Output 585178ebc7f72993406f9b7a85fddb8814317f1803e97ae6d3fdfe7ae78a2e0a:3

value
102992247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e96ec40d14ae0030e30c1fe0066eae698924d13 OP_EQUAL
address
MLu6yyUbkVhovLKTQk5ckr6xmcjbsfPqPh
transaction
585178ebc7f72993406f9b7a85fddb8814317f1803e97ae6d3fdfe7ae78a2e0a
spent
true